Florentine Tomato Soup Recipe

"Green pepper, basil and diced tomatoes are simmered with garlic and bouillon, then combined with spinach in this easy soup."

Original Recipe Yield 5 servings
 

Ingredients

  • 1 teaspoon olive oil
  • 1/2 cup chopped green bell pepper
  • 1/2 cup chopped onion
  • 1 clove garlic, minced
  • 1 (14.5 ounce) can diced tomatoes
  • 1 1/2 cups water
  • 1 tablespoon minced fresh basil
  • 1 teaspoon chicken bouillon granules
  • 1/4 te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 1 (10 ounce) package frozen chopped spinach, thawed

Directions

  1. In a large saucepan over medium heat, cook bell pepper, onion and garlic in oil until tender. Stir in tomatoes, water, basil, bouillon and black pepper.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er 10 minutes.
  2. Stir in spinach and cook 5 to 7 minutes more.
